Mediterranean Couscous Salad
This Mediterranean Couscous Salad is a vibrant and refreshing dish, perfect as a side that bursts with flavor from fresh vegetables and herbs. It combines fluffy couscous with a medley of Mediterranean ingredients, making it a delightful addition to any meal.

Ingredients
- couscous - 100 grams
- boiling water - 150 ml
- cherry tomatoes - 100 grams, halved
- cucumber - 1 medium, diced
- red bell pepper - 1/2, diced
- red onion - 1/4, finely chopped
- kalamata olives - 50 grams, pitted and sliced
- feta cheese - 50 grams, crumbled
- fresh parsley - 2 tablespoons, chopped
- fresh mint - 1 tablespoon, chopped
- olive oil - 2 tablespoons
- lemon juice - 1 tablespoon
- salt - to taste
- black pepper - to taste
Steps
- In a medium bowl, combine the couscous and boiling water. Cover and let sit for 5 minutes until the couscous absorbs the water.
- Fluff the couscous with a fork and let it cool to room temperature.
- In a large bowl, combine the cherry tomatoes, cucumber, red bell pepper, red onion, kalamata olives, feta cheese, parsley, and mint.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, lemon juice, salt, and black pepper.
- Add the cooled couscous to the large bowl of vegetables and herbs. Pour the dressing over the top and gently mix until everything is well combined.
- Taste and adjust seasoning if necessary. Serve chilled or at room temperature.
